Joker Online Casino in Malaysia: Top Slots and Live Casino 126asia.com
Try Joker Online Casino In Malaysia at 126asia.com for top-quality online slots, interactive features, live dealer action, and endless opportunities for online casino rewards.
Report Story
Leave Your Comment